Output 628c2b7eb821edb3b30e564b232e8be9fb7d1ef7037d83a4d7c31a604c83809e:0

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9da639bc565741ffd2343d5de98b2212d66342d OP_EQUAL
address
3JdiYyNdLZ21cuixBet7Lm4qkf8UKKuovP
transaction
628c2b7eb821edb3b30e564b232e8be9fb7d1ef7037d83a4d7c31a604c83809e
spent
true